Minutes — Management Meeting, Reseller Programme

Present: heads of sales, finance, channel ops. Prepared for the incoming director.

1. Programme performance reviewed: partner revenue up 14% quarter on quarter.
2. Agreed to tighten certification requirements for the Merrow tier from next intake.
3. Finance to model margin impact of proposed rebate change; due in two weeks.
4. Exit process initiated for two dormant partners.
5. Next meeting set for month end.

The confidential note on forward plans is recorded below.

confidential, kagep-kahof: Druokax Systems plans to lower the Ulaath list price by 53 percent in March.

## v7.1.0 — Changed defaults

Password reset revamp (Quillgate) ships enabled by default. Token TTL cut from 60 to 15 minutes. Rate limit now per-account, not per-IP. Legacy email templates removed; fallback is the new plaintext set. Reset links are single-use. Release manager: confirm downstream mailers were redeployed before promoting. No migration needed; defaults apply on restart. The full set of new default configuration values follows below.

service settings:
[silwyn]
host = silwyn.crelvogrid.internal
user = silwyn_svc
database = silwyn_prod

## Runbook: Gaugepile Sidecar — Release Checklist

Heads up: the sidecar ships with every app pod, so a bad config fans out fast. Before cutting a release, confirm the flush interval hasn't drifted from what the Tallyhouse aggregator expects, or you'll see sawtooth gaps in dashboards. Rollbacks are cheap — just repin the image tag. Canary one node pool first, watch for ten minutes, then proceed. The values to verify against are these.

config for bagep-yafof:
quenath:
  pin: 8584
  metrics_host: metrics.quenath.tolvaqsys.internal
  tenant: pelath
  seal: seal_ed102645